Dive into Cloud Mining: A Gateway to Bitcoin without Hardware Hassles

Looking to invest in Bitcoin but don't want to deal with the demands of hardware setup and maintenance? Explore cloud mining, a revolutionary way to join in the Bitcoin world without lifting a finger. Cloud mining allows you to utilize powerful computing infrastructure cloud mining from specialized providers, effectively outsourcing the operation to them.

This expedites your Bitcoin journey, letting you focus your time and energy to other aspects of the copyright market.

With cloud mining, you subscribe to a share of computing power, and in return, you receive a proportion of the Bitcoins generated by that shared hardware. It's a flexible way to enter the world of Bitcoin without the technical hurdles often associated with traditional mining.
